Beyond Algorithms: Social Representations and the Public Understanding of AI
Beyond Algorithms: Social Representations and the Public Understanding of AI
This book explores how artificial intelligence is understood, debated, and socially constructed across different social, cultural, and institutional contexts. This volume examines the meanings, hopes, fears, and controversies associated with AI in domains such as education, health, work, ethics, communication, and public policy.
